What they do

A Dietary Aide works in kitchens such as hospital kitchens where cooking is done to meet specific dietary requirements. Assists with food preparation and other tasks.

Job Description

The Grand at Barnwell is seeking weekend Dietary aides. Saturday and Sundays 7am-7pm $16-$18 hourly
Key Responsibilities:
Dish room
Operations :
Operate the dish machine, clean the dish room, and wash pots, pans, and sort silverware.
Food Preparation & Tray Setup :
Prepare sandwiches and set up the tray line with condiments.
Meal Delivery :
Deliver food carts to units and organize resident tickets.
Beverage & Soup Service :
Pour coffee, soups, and clean the coffee pot.
Maintain Cleanliness :
Sweep, mop, and ensure cleanliness in dining areas, storerooms, and other kitchen areas.
Restocking & Waste Management :
Restock supplies, manage leftovers, and dispose of trash.
Additional Duties :
Assist with other tasks as assigned by management.
Dietary Aide Requirements:
Education :
High school diploma or equivalent.
Physical Capability :
Ability to perform physical tasks, including lifting and standing for extended periods.
Experience :
Experience in food service is a plus.
Teamwork :
Positive attitude and strong ability to collaborate with others.
Reliability :
Dependable transportation is required.
